About the role

Join Lake Assault Boats as a Welder/Fabricator and contribute to the creation of innovative marine craft. Enjoy competitive pay ranging from $17.50 to $34.12 per hour, along with comprehensive benefits including medical, dental, vision, 401(k), life insurance, health savings account, flexible spending account, paid time off, and equipment stipend.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ze engineering drawings, blueprints, and specifications to plan layout and assembly operations
  • Utilize MIG and TIG welding skills to produce high-quality welds in various positions
  • Maintain quality and accuracy in work
  • Operate safety equipment and power-assisted tools
  • Assist in the preparation, loading, and unloading of high-speed watercraft

Requirements

  • Robust skill set in welding, fabrication, and fitting
  • Familiarity with standard build practices in manufacturing environments
  • Knowledge and expertise in aluminum welding
  • Ability to follow directions and procedures with limited supervision
  • Effective communication skills for clear information exchange
  • Strong mathematical abilities for task understanding and problem-solving
  • Critical thinking skills to evaluate alternative solutions
  • Time management for task prioritization
  • Physical stamina for grasping, bending, lifting up to 50 lbs, and navigating tight spaces

Qualifications

  • A Weld Certificate or technical education preferred
  • Candidates must pass a qualification test

Schedule

Position requires working in an indoor and heated shop, with physical requirements including grasping, writing, standing, sitting, walking, kneeling, crawling, repetitive motions, bending, climbing, listening and hearing ability, and visual acuity. Must be able to work in tight spaces and operate manufacturing equipment. Work may occur in areas not environmentally controlled and involve moving, lifting, pulling, pushing up to 50 lbs, and navigating high-speed watercraft in variable weather conditions.
